挖掘深度数据的方法包括:使用高级分析工具、进行多维数据分析、结合机器学习算法、数据清洗与预处理、数据可视化。 其中,使用高级分析工具是挖掘深度数据的关键步骤。这些工具能够处理大规模数据集,提供丰富的分析功能和灵活的数据操作方式。例如,使用Python的Pandas库进行数据处理和分析,或使用SQL进行复杂查询,这些工具能够帮助用户挖掘出数据背后的深层次信息。此外,结合机器学习算法可以进一步提高数据挖掘的效果,通过自动化模式识别和预测分析,帮助用户从海量数据中发现潜在规律和趋势。
一、使用高级分析工具
使用高级分析工具是挖掘深度数据的基础和关键。高级分析工具包括Python的Pandas库、R语言、SQL等,它们具备处理大规模数据集的能力,并提供丰富的数据操作和分析功能。Pandas库在数据清洗、数据转换和数据分析方面表现出色。通过Pandas,用户可以轻松实现数据筛选、聚合、分组等操作。SQL则适用于对关系型数据库进行复杂查询,能够快速提取所需数据。R语言以其强大的统计分析和数据可视化功能,广泛应用于数据科学领域。结合这些工具,可以大大提升数据挖掘的效率和效果。
二、进行多维数据分析
多维数据分析是深度数据挖掘中的重要环节。它通过对数据进行多维度切片和钻取,帮助用户发现数据的内在联系和潜在规律。多维数据分析通常使用在线分析处理(OLAP)技术,用户可以通过OLAP工具对数据进行多维度的切片和旋转,快速获取所需信息。多维数据分析不仅限于简单的数值统计,还包括对时间、地理位置、产品类别等多维度的综合分析。例如,通过分析不同时间段的销售数据,可以发现季节性销售趋势;通过分析不同地区的客户数据,可以发现区域市场的差异。多维数据分析为企业决策提供了重要依据。
三、结合机器学习算法
机器学习算法在深度数据挖掘中扮演着重要角色。它通过自动化模式识别和预测分析,帮助用户从海量数据中发现潜在规律和趋势。常用的机器学习算法包括监督学习、无监督学习和强化学习。监督学习算法如线性回归、决策树、支持向量机等,适用于已知标签的数据集,可以用于分类和回归任务。无监督学习算法如聚类分析、主成分分析等,适用于未知标签的数据集,可以用于数据降维和模式识别。强化学习算法通过不断试错和学习,适用于动态环境下的决策优化。结合机器学习算法,可以大幅提高数据挖掘的智能化和自动化水平。
四、数据清洗与预处理
数据清洗与预处理是深度数据挖掘的前提和基础。数据清洗包括处理缺失值、重复值和异常值,保证数据的完整性和一致性。缺失值可以通过填补、删除或插值等方法处理;重复值可以通过去重操作清除;异常值可以通过箱线图、Z分数等方法识别和处理。数据预处理包括数据标准化、归一化和编码转换等,以提高数据的质量和可用性。标准化可以消除不同量纲数据之间的差异;归一化可以将数据缩放到同一范围内;编码转换可以将分类数据转换为数值数据,便于后续分析。高质量的数据清洗与预处理是保证数据挖掘效果的关键。
五、数据可视化
数据可视化是深度数据挖掘的有效手段。通过图形化展示数据,能够直观地呈现数据的分布、趋势和关系,帮助用户快速理解和发现数据中的重要信息。常用的数据可视化工具包括Matplotlib、Seaborn、Tableau等。Matplotlib和Seaborn是Python中的两个强大绘图库,能够生成各种类型的图表,如折线图、柱状图、散点图、热力图等。Tableau是一款专业的数据可视化软件,提供丰富的图表类型和交互功能,用户可以通过拖拽操作轻松创建复杂的可视化报表。数据可视化不仅可以用于数据分析结果的展示,还可以用于数据探索过程中的模式识别和异常检测。
六、挖掘深度数据的实际应用案例
深度数据挖掘在各行各业中都有广泛应用。以电子商务为例,通过深度数据挖掘,可以分析用户的购买行为,发现用户偏好,进行个性化推荐,提升用户满意度和销售额。通过分析用户的浏览记录、购物车数据和购买历史,可以建立用户画像,预测用户的购买意向,进行精准营销。金融行业通过深度数据挖掘,可以进行信用风险评估、欺诈检测和投资组合优化。通过分析客户的财务数据、交易记录和信用评分,可以评估客户的信用风险,发现潜在的欺诈行为,优化投资组合策略。医疗行业通过深度数据挖掘,可以进行疾病预测、个性化治疗和公共卫生监测。通过分析患者的病历数据、基因数据和医疗影像数据,可以预测疾病的发生发展,制定个性化治疗方案,监测公共卫生事件的发生和传播。
七、未来发展趋势
随着大数据和人工智能技术的快速发展,深度数据挖掘将迎来更多的机遇和挑战。未来,深度数据挖掘将更加注重数据的实时性和多样性,进一步提高数据分析的智能化和自动化水平。实时数据挖掘将通过流数据处理技术,实现对实时数据的快速分析和响应,支持实时决策和动态优化。多样性数据挖掘将通过多源数据融合技术,整合结构化数据、非结构化数据和半结构化数据,实现对多样性数据的全面分析和深度挖掘。人工智能技术将进一步融入数据挖掘过程,通过深度学习、强化学习等算法,提升数据挖掘的智能化水平,实现自动化模式识别、预测分析和决策优化。
八、挑战与解决方案
深度数据挖掘面临的主要挑战包括数据质量问题、计算资源瓶颈和隐私安全问题。数据质量问题可以通过加强数据清洗与预处理,提高数据的完整性和一致性。计算资源瓶颈可以通过分布式计算和云计算技术,提高数据处理和分析的效率。隐私安全问题可以通过数据加密、访问控制和隐私保护技术,保障数据的安全性和隐私性。此外,数据挖掘过程中还需要注重数据伦理问题,避免因数据使用不当导致的伦理争议和法律风险。通过不断技术创新和规范化管理,可以有效应对深度数据挖掘面临的挑战,实现数据价值的最大化。
九、结论与展望
深度数据挖掘是大数据时代的重要技术,通过挖掘数据背后的深层次信息,可以为企业决策、科学研究和社会治理提供重要支持。使用高级分析工具、进行多维数据分析、结合机器学习算法、数据清洗与预处理和数据可视化是挖掘深度数据的关键步骤。在实际应用中,深度数据挖掘已经在电子商务、金融、医疗等领域取得了显著成效。随着大数据和人工智能技术的不断发展,深度数据挖掘将迎来更多的机遇和挑战。未来,通过加强技术创新和规范化管理,可以进一步提升深度数据挖掘的智能化和自动化水平,实现数据价值的最大化。
相关问答FAQs:
挖掘深度数据的基本概念是什么?
挖掘深度数据是一个涉及从大量复杂数据中提取有价值信息的过程。深度数据通常指的是不仅仅包括表面数据(如交易记录、用户行为等),还包括更复杂的、非结构化的数据(如社交媒体内容、图像、视频等)。为了有效挖掘深度数据,通常需要结合数据科学、机器学习和人工智能等领域的技术。通过对数据的清洗、预处理和分析,能够发现潜在的模式、趋势和关系,从而为决策提供支持。例如,在电商领域,分析用户评论和反馈不仅可以了解消费者的偏好,还能帮助企业优化产品和服务。
挖掘深度数据需要哪些工具和技术?
挖掘深度数据涉及使用多种工具和技术来处理和分析数据。首先,数据采集工具如Web爬虫和API接口可以帮助收集各类数据。接下来,数据清洗工具(如Pandas、OpenRefine)用于处理缺失值和异常值,确保数据的质量。数据分析通常使用统计分析软件(如R、SAS)和数据库管理系统(如MySQL、MongoDB)来存储和检索数据。机器学习框架(如TensorFlow、PyTorch)能够帮助构建预测模型和分类器,从而深入挖掘数据背后的规律。此外,数据可视化工具(如Tableau、Power BI)可以将分析结果以直观的方式呈现,便于理解和分享。
挖掘深度数据能带来哪些具体的业务价值?
深度数据的挖掘能够为各行各业带来显著的业务价值。对于零售行业,通过分析顾客的购买历史和社交媒体反馈,企业可以精准地进行市场细分,提供个性化的推荐,从而提高销售转化率。在金融领域,深度数据分析可以帮助识别潜在的欺诈行为,通过监测交易模式和用户行为来预防损失。在医疗健康行业,分析患者的电子健康记录和基因组数据,可以支持个性化治疗方案和预防措施的制定。此外,深度数据的挖掘也能助力企业在产品研发、市场营销和客户服务等方面进行更为科学的决策,进而提升整体的竞争力和市场响应速度。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。